Subtle increase in leukocyte counts in association with drinking and smoking habits.

Abstract

Peripheral leukocyte counts were examined in venous blood of more than 800 male workers exposed to toluene, xylenes, a combination of the two, or neither. Information on the social habits of smoking and drinking was obtained in an occupational health interview. The analysis showed that smoking (15 cigarettes/day on average) induced a significant increase (by 7%) in leukocyte counts, and that an additional increase was induced when the drinking habit was coupled with smoking. Drinking alone tended to increase the leukocyte counts but the effect was statistically nonsignificant, possibly because the number of nondrinking smokers was limited. The study stresses the importance of paying attention to smoking and drinking habits when evaluating hematological parameters such as peripheral leukocyte counts in solvent-exposed workers.
